A battling performance from Harriers helped them to their first unbeaten "run" since August with their second consecutive draw although it was not enough to save them from returning to the bottom of the league with results elsewhere going against them - Cambridge won for the second time in two games to move above them. The most surprising change to the team was the demotion of Simon Weaver to the subs' bench, his place went to Johnny Mullins who had shaken off the hamstring injury picked up in the midweek draw with Bristol Rovers and Lee Jenkins came in at right back. Skipper Wayne Hatswell continued at left back and new signing Mark Rawle had to be content with a place on the bench. A scrappy first half almost began in the worst possible way for Harriers after just seven minutes when the home team had the ball in the back of the net; a free kick from deep on the right was headed in at the far post by Greg Heald but the goal was not allowed to stand because Heald had fouled John Danby to get to the ball. After this let-off Harriers began to get themselves into the game and deservedly, albeit out of the blue, took the lead after 17 minutes when an unmarked Chris Beardsley rose to head in Wayne Hatswell's left-wing cross with home keeper Matthew Gilks motionless on his line as the ball dropped into the bottom corner in slow motion. Despite having plenty of possession Harriers were not creating too much in front of goal and it was little surprise when Dale equalised five minutes before the break - no surprise that they scored and even less surprise that it came from a Harriers mistake. A poor header by Tom Bennett in the penalty area fell to Marcus Richardson who laid it back to Gary Jones, his shot was well saved but Rickie Lambert was on hand to head in the loose ball to register his first goal for the club. The second half was no less scrappy, the hoe team offered no threat to Harriers but equally Harriers little threat to them although it was the visitors who had the best of the chances in the second period. On the hour mark god work by Blair Sturrock on the right almost set up Bertrand Cozic but before he was able to get a shot in Scott Warner cleared the ball off his toe at the expense of a corner. At the other end Jones put in alan Goodhall seconds after the latter had come on as a sub for Ernie Cooksey and he was denied only by the sped of Danby who was quickly off his line to parry his effort out of play. Harriers didn't show any real urgency to win the game until the final ten minutes. A corner from the right was almost headed in by Mark Jackson but Dale managed to scramble the ball clear. Then, after Jenkins had blocked Lambert's 30-yard free-kick for a corner Dean Keates made a surging run through the middle of the park before finding Rawle, on for Beardsley, on the left, his cross to the far post fell invitingly for Sturrock but he blazed his shot over the bar. A Bennett pass through the middle found Sturrock on the edge of the penalty area but, after a good turn, he shot weakly at Gilks and the home team were happy to see out stoppage time and hold on for a point. |
